How do hybrid inverters contribute to energy savings and sustainability?
Hybrid inverters play a pivotal role in advancing energy savings and sustainability within modern electrical systems. By seamlessly integrating renewable energy sources, such as solar panels, with traditional power grids, these inverters optimise energy use and reduce reliance on non-renewable resources. This not only lowers energy costs but also mitigates environmental impact, making hybrid inverters an attractive choice for both residential and commercial applications.
Moreover, hybrid inverters offer the flexibility to store excess energy in batteries for later use. This capability ensures a steady power supply during peak demand or outages, further enhancing energy efficiency. By balancing energy production and consumption, hybrid inverters contribute significantly to sustainable energy management, aligning with global efforts to reduce carbon footprints and promote green energy solutions.

Firstly, hybrid inverters enhance energy savings by efficiently managing and distributing electricity generated from renewable sources. They intelligently switch between solar power and grid electricity, ensuring that the most cost-effective and clean energy source is utilised at any given time. This smart energy management reduces electricity bills and dependency on fossil fuels, contributing to both economic and environmental sustainability.
Secondly, these inverters support energy storage solutions, which are crucial for maximising the benefits of renewable energy. By storing surplus energy produced during sunny periods, hybrid inverters ensure that stored electricity can be used when production is low, such as during the night or on cloudy days. This ability to store and use energy on demand not only increases self-consumption of renewable power but also enhances grid stability.
Lastly, hybrid inverters aid in reducing carbon emissions by facilitating the integration of renewable energy into daily energy consumption. By prioritising the use of clean energy sources, they significantly decrease the reliance on conventional power plants, which are often associated with higher carbon emissions. As a result, hybrid inverters are instrumental in promoting a more sustainable and eco-friendly energy landscape.
